## Changelog — Resetgate revamp (defaults changed)

Password reset flow rebuilt. Token lifetime shortened, single-use enforced, rate limiting now per-account instead of per-IP. Old email templates removed; the new ones render from Lintbox. Reset links no longer embed the account hint. If you joined after this release, ignore any docs mentioning the legacy flow — it's gone. New team members should confirm their local env uses the updated defaults, listed below.

deployment values, fahap-hahaf:
[casdor]
port = 9200
region = south-2
host = casdor.qirvanworks.corp
timeout_ms = 3000
retries = 4

### Release Checklist — Step 7: Verify Lanternkit Versioning

Before publishing the Lanternkit shared component library, confirm that the version in the root manifest, the changelog header, and the generated docs banner all match exactly. New contractors often miss the docs banner, which is written during a separate build stage and can lag by one release. Run the version audit script, resolve any mismatch before tagging, and never hand-edit the lockfile. Once the audit passes, record the value it prints directly below.

session token of yahof-bajeg = htk9_0d43d44ed

## Changelog — Font vendoring defaults changed

As of this release, the Bracken UI build no longer fetches third-party fonts at build time. All typefaces used by the Lanternwell suite are now vendored into the repo under a dedicated assets directory, and the fetch step is skipped by default. If you're onboarding, nothing to install — the fonts travel with the checkout. The build flags controlling this behavior are listed below.

settings of hadup-yafog:
LAMAEL_PIN=3761
LAMAEL_TENANT=istmir
LAMAEL_METRICS_HOST=metrics.lamael.plorvasys.test
LAMAEL_SEAL=seal_8ea68500
LAMAEL_STANDBY_TEAM=fraok

The Lattervane migration API applies schema changes in two phases: an additive pass that runs while traffic continues, followed by a cleanup pass after all replicas confirm. Support staff can inspect migration progress through the status endpoint, which reports phase, lag, and any blocked writers. Polling every ten seconds is safe. All status requests must include the bearer token shown below.

session JWT of tadup-kaguf = eyJhbGciOiJIUzI1NiIsInR5cCI6IkpXVCJ9.eyJzdWIiOiItNz4V3In0.KrZCeqpk